I have a Logitech Internet Navigator too, and it works quite well. Definitely no 3-key lock on this one.
 In a thread on cl2k, the legend of ninja roping Anubis recommended an IBM Rapid Access II or IBM Rapid Access III. I haven't tried one myself but he reckons the space bar and arrow keys are quite good. Best thing about them is the price though. Not sure whether this one would have a 3-key lock, you could always test it in the shop if you get a chance.
 
 Dell keyboards like Glenn mentions are nice too, though the newest ones I've seen have the Insert/Delete/Home/End/PageUp/PageDown keys arranged in 3 rows rather than 2. I guess you could get used to that though.
